One of the most commonly used sustainable materials in high rise buildings is recycled steel. Steel is a vital component of many high rise structures due to its strength and versatility. However, producing new steel from raw materials can be extremely energy-intensive and environmentally damaging. By using recycled steel, builders can reduce the demand for new steel production and save significant amounts of energy. Recycled steel is just as strong and durable as new steel, making it an excellent choice for high rise construction.

Another popular sustainable material for high rise buildings is cross-laminated timber (CLT). CLT is a type of engineered wood that is made by gluing together layers of lumber at right angles to each other. This creates a strong and durable material that can be used for floors, walls, and roofs of high rise buildings. CLT has excellent thermal properties, which can help reduce energy consumption for heating and cooling. Additionally, using wood in construction helps to sequester carbon, making CLT a highly sustainable choice for high rise buildings.

Bamboo is another sustainable material that is gaining popularity in high rise construction. Bamboo is a fast-growing plant that can be harvested in as little as 3-5 years, making it a highly renewable resource. Bamboo is also incredibly strong and flexible, making it an excellent choice for structural elements in high rise buildings. Additionally, bamboo has natural anti-bacterial properties, which can help improve indoor air quality. By using bamboo in construction, builders can reduce their reliance on traditional building materials like concrete and steel, which have a much larger environmental footprint.

Recycled glass is another sustainable material that is being used in high rise buildings to improve energy efficiency and aesthetics. Glass is a key component of modern skyscrapers, providing natural light and stunning views for occupants. By using recycled glass, builders can reduce the energy and resources required to produce new glass from raw materials. Additionally, recycled glass can help improve insulation, reducing the need for artificial heating and cooling. Recycled glass can also be used to create beautiful facade designs that add a unique aesthetic appeal to high rise buildings.
